RENAISSANCE DAY RETREAT
A RENAISSANCE PRE-GAME FOR YOUR BODY + MIND + SOUL
TO SUPPORT BLACK PRIDE NOLA
Are y’all ready for the Queen Bey to descend upon New Orleans? The Haus of Glitter + Black Pride NOLA + Dream House Lounge are joining forces for a community wellness retreat to practice care, healing, restoration and ferocity together. Yes, there will be Beyonce runways…
1pm Oxygen Bar + Tea Time Meet N Greet
1:30pm Restorative Beyonce Yoga
2:30pm Break
3:15pm Intro: Vogue + Ballroom Dance Werkshop
When community gathers to practice breath + rest + dance together, it is a protest against the system that tells us our bodies are only valuable for producing profit. Breathe with us. Slay with us. Disrupt with us. The Renaissance is here, y’all.
ALL ARE WELCOME:
New to wellness // yoga // meditation // dance? Come! ALL BODIES ARE WELCOME - especially BIPOC + LGBTQ+ community. Come late. Leave early. Take a nap or journal in the corner and ignore our directions. This is a care-centered space to love our bodies. Judgement, hate, racism, misogyny, homophobia & transphobia will not be tolerated. Dress comfortably. NO ONE WILL BE TURNED AWAY DUE TO LACK OF FUNDS.
THIS IS A 50/50 FUNDRAISER:
50% of proceeds support the vital community wellness + advocacy work of Black Pride NOLA, one of the few Black Femme-led Pride Festivals in the country.
50% of proceeds support The Haus of Glitter’s activist campaign to transform the racist national monument dedicated to slavery ship commander, Esek Hopkins.

THE DREAM HOUSE LOUNGE + FOUNDATION
Is a Queer Black owned mental + spiritual community wellness lounge and cafe that offers tea, coffee, mocktails, oxygen therapy, and liberation-centered wellness programming. For Dream House Lounge + Foundation, it’s not enough to survive, we practice soul-care (e.g. meditation, yoga, mindfulness, alternative healing, community healing conversations) so that our future generations can thrive. We dream big and exercise imagination, in pursuit of peace, love, and liberation. Learn more at www.dhlounge.com @dhlounge
